@ARTICLE{Wołczyński_W._Entropy_2020, author={Wołczyński, W.}, volume={vol. 65}, number={No 1}, journal={Archives of Metallurgy and Materials}, pages={403-416}, howpublished={online}, year={2020}, publisher={Institute of Metallurgy and Materials Science of Polish Academy of Sciences}, publisher={Committee of Materials Engineering and Metallurgy of Polish Academy of Sciences}, abstract={The entropy production per unit time is calculated for the regular lamellae -, and for the regular rods formation, respectively. The entropy production is a function of some parameters which define the eutectic phase diagram, coefficient of the diffusion in the liquid, and some capillary parameters connected with the mechanical equilibrium located at the triple point of the solid/liquid interface. Minimization of the entropy production allowed to formulate mathematically the so-called Growth Law for both envisaged eutectic morphologies.}, type={Article}, title={Entropy Production in the Stationary Eutectic Growth}, URL={http://journals.pan.pl/Content/115074/PDF/AMM-2020-1-50-Wolczynski.pdf}, doi={10.24425/amm.2020.131743}, keywords={Regular eutectics growth, Entropy production, Criterion of minimum entropy production, Growth Law}, }
